BIAXIALLY-STRETCHED POLYAMIDE FILM

摘要

PROBLEM TO BE SOLVED: To provide a biaxially-stretched polyamide film preferably usable for a household electric appliance, an automobile member, a building material member, food package or the like by giving formability, and to provide a laminate using the film.;SOLUTION: The biaxially-stretched polyamide film is obtained by stretching a cast film containing a polyamide-based resin composed of 85 to 50 wt.% of an aliphatic polyamide and 15 to 50 wt.% of a half-aromatic polyamide by 2 to 4 times in both the vertical and lateral directions, and then heat-setting the film so that hot water shrinkage ratios after treatment at 95°C for 5 minutes in both the vertical and lateral directions become 0 to 5%, wherein the product (Emt) of multiplying an elongation at break in the vertical direction at 80°C by an elongation at break in the lateral direction at 80°C is in the range from 2.5 to 10.;COPYRIGHT: (C)2010,JPO&INPIT
